This is a trouser design for a five-year-old girl. You can make this in a larger size as well. So let me share my method with you.


First of all, I cut the trousers in the same simple way as you would cut trousers, but along with that, I cut a four-inch piece of the frock fabric that I will attach to the side of the trouser, along with which I also have to design.



Then I started folding the frock fabric I was going to design. I folded the fabric by stitching it from the side.


After folding the fabric from the side, it looked something like this. Then I folded the fabric by stitching the bottom of the fabric with a stitch.


Then I opened it up to eight inches from the bottom to the top, and I covered the remaining fabric inside and stitched it.


After the trousers were completely sewn, I made and attached a flower on top, which is a flower made from the frock fabric.
